#e722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e722ce is composed of 90.6% red, 13.3%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.3% magenta, 10.8%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 307.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 52%. #e722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44ff with #cf009d.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#e722ce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e722ce has RGB values of R:231, G:34,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.11,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15147726.

Hex triplet e722ce #e722ce
RGB Decimal 231, 34, 206 rgb(231,34,206)
RGB Percent 90.6, 13.3, 80.8 rgb(90.6%,13.3%,80.8%)
CMYK 0, 85, 11, 9
HSL 307.6°, 80.4, 52 hsl(307.6,80.4%,52%)
HSV (or HSB) 307.6°, 85.3, 90.6
Web Safe ff33cc #ff33cc
CIE-LAB 54.65, 84.208, -42.519
XYZ 44.667, 22.593, 60.398
xyY 0.35, 0.177, 22.593
CIE-LCH 54.65, 94.333, 333.209
CIE-LUV 54.65, 84.209, -76.937
Hunter-Lab 47.532, 84.562, -42.066
Binary 11100111, 00100010, 11001110

Shades and Tints of #e722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090108 is the darkest color, while #fef6fd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#e722ce is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#717171 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#896184 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#2c85ff Protanopia 1% of men
  • #7388bd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#dd5f64 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7061ed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9d62c3 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#e0488b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
